Isaiah 9:6b, “For to us a child is born, to us a Son is given,” is a powerful prophecy foretelling the coming of Jesus-Christ, the Messiah. This verse, nestled within a passage of hope and comfort amidst a time of political and social turmoil in ancient Israel, speaks of a future king who would bring peace and salvation. The context highlights the desperate need for a deliverer, a leader who would break the chains of oppression and usher in an era of justice and righteousness.
The phrase “a Son is Given to us” carries profound implications. The act of giving signifies a gift, a freely offered blessing, not something earned or deserved. This emphasizes God’s grace and initiative in providing salvation. The “Son” refers to Jesus, who is both fully God and fully human, bridging the gap between humanity and divinity. He is the ultimate sacrifice, the perfect atonement for our sins, and the embodiment of Gd’s love for the World.
This message resonates deeply today. In a world often characterized by conflict, injustice, and despair, the promise of a “Son given to us” offers solace and hope. Jesus’s life, death, and resurrection demonstrate God’s unwavering commitment to humanity, offering forgiveness, reconciliation, and the promise of eternal life.
By accepting this gift, we can experience the transformative power of God’s love and find strength to navigate the challenges of life. The gift of Jesus is not just a historian event; it is a present reality, available to all who believe.

In the prophecy of Isaiah 9:6a, we encounter a profound declaration that captures the heart of hope and divine intervention: “For to us a child is born.”This simple yet transformative phrase offers us a glimpse into God’s redemptive plan to humanity through the incarnation of Jesus-Christ.
The essence of this prophecy is rooted in the humble arrival of a child. In a world filled with chaos and uncertainty, the birth of a child symbolizes new beginnings and possibilities. It is a reminder that the most significant changes often stem from the most unassuming beginnings. Here, we see that God’s answer to our deepest longings and the resolution of our struggles does not come through might or power, but through the vulnerability of a newborn.
when Isaiah speaks of a child being born, it signifies not just the inception of a life but the advent of hope itself. The idea that God chooses to come to us in form of a child emphasizes His love and willingness to be intimately involved in our human experience. This prophecy reassures us that salvation and peace are not distant ideals but accessible gifts brought to us through the simplest of means-a child.
In the context of Isaiah’s time, this prophecy was a beacon of hope for a people living in darkness. It speaks to the context of oppression and despair, affirming that even in dire circumstances, God has a plan to restore and deliver His people. The birth of this child signifies a turning point-a divine intervention that promises not just a change in political or social circumstances, but a fundamental transformation of human heart.
As we meditate on this profound truth, let us consider the implications of a child being born. What does it mean for us to acknowledge the humble nature of this gift? How can we embody the hope that this child represents in our own lives? The birth of Christ invites us to reflect on the themes of innocence, humility, and promise. It calls us to foster these qualities within ourselves and to share them with the world around us.
Thus, “For us a Child is born” is not merely an announcement of birth, it is an invitation to embrace hope, love, and transformation. As we celebrate this prophecy, let us hold fast to the promise it brings and allow it to inspire our lives. May we recognize that in eery child born, there is the potential hope anew, a reminder of God’s persistent grace, and the enduring promise of light in our darkest days.
